How can AI and big data help reduce energy consumption, cut emissions, and build more sustainable industries and communities?

 

COSMIC is a European project bringing together industry leaders, technology providers, and innovators to develop and scale AI-driven solutions that support the EU Green Deal. With 15 pilots across Europe, COSMIC demonstrates how advanced technologies can optimise energy use, improve resource efficiency, and accelerate the green transition.

WHAT WILL COSMIC ACHIEVE?

15 pilots testing AI & data-driven solutions across multiple industries
 

10-20% reduction in energy consumption in buildings, industry, and transport

Up to 27 AI-powered solutions tested in real-world settings and can be scaled

Increased renewable energy use, making communities more energy-resilient

THE COSMIC PROCESS

Selecting innovations through Open Calls

We fund innovative AI & data-driven solutions from startups and SMEs and apply them to sustainability projects across different industries.

Testing and integration in pilots

Selected innovations are deployed alongside existing core technologies in our 15 pilots, optimising energy and resource efficiency in real-world conditions.

Scaling up for long-term impact

We ensure solutions are scalable and replicable, sharing results with industries, policymakers, and communities to drive widespread adoption.
